Abstract

LA INVENCION SE REFIERE A UN PROCEDIMIENTO DE PRODUCCION DE PARTICULAS DE HIDROXIAPATITA ESFERICAS, NO POROSAS, CON UN TAMAÑO NO SUPERIOR A 250 MICRONES Y UNA DENSIDAD DE AL MENOS 3,00 G/CC. DICHO PROCEDIMIENTO CONSISTE EN AGLOMERAR EN PRESENCIA DE AGUA COMO UNICO ADITIVO, UNA CARGA DE ALIMENTACION DE HIDROXIAPATITA EN POLVO, CON UNA PUREZA DE AL MENOS EL 97 %, Y CON IMPUREZAS METALICAS QUE SUPEREN LAS 500 PPM, PARA FORMAR PARTICULAS DE HIDROXIAPATITA CON UN TAMAÑO NO SUPERIOR A 350 MICRONES. A CONTINUACION, DICHAS PARTICULAS SE SECAN Y SINTERIZAN A UNA TEMPERATURA COMPRENDIDA ENTRE APROX. 1.100 Y 1,200 °C, PRODUCIENDO PARTICULAS DE HIDROXIAPATITA ESFERICAS, NO POROSAS, DE TAMAÑO NO SUPERIOR A 250 MICRONES Y DE DENSIDAD AL MENOS 3,00 G/CC. DICHAS PARTICULAS PRESENTAN DIVERSOS USOS MEDICOS, INCLUYENDO EL REEMPLAZAMIENTO DE HUESOS, REVESTIMIENTOS DE IMPLANTES Y APLICACIONES DENTALES, COMO EL AUMENTO DEL REBORDE ALVEOLAR, OBTURACIONES DE CAVIDADES TRAS LA EXTRACCION DE RAICES DENTALES, RESTAURACION DE LESIONES OSEAS PERIODONTALES Y AUMENTO DE LOS TEJIDOS BLANDOS.
